Job Title: Food Technology Teacher/Instructor (SEMH Setting)
Location: Essex
Start Date: September 2025
Contract: Full-Time, Temporary with potential for permanent placement
Salary: Competitive, dependent on experience

Are you passionate about inspiring young people through Food Technology?
TeacherActive are seeking a dedicated and enthusiastic Food Technology Teacher/Instructor to join a specialized SEMH (Social, Emotional, and Mental Health) setting in Essex starting September 2025.

About the Role:

  • Deliver engaging Food Technology lessons tailored to students with SEMH needs
  • Support and motivate students to develop practical cooking skills and a love for healthy eating
  • Create a positive, inclusive classroom environment that promotes social and emotional development
  • Collaborate with a dedicated team of educators and support staff to meet individual student needs
  • Adapt teaching strategies to ensure all students can access the curriculum effectively

Requirements:

  •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or equivalent in Food Technology or related subject
  • Experience working with students with SEMH needs is desirable but not essential — training will be provided
  • Passionate about making a difference in students’ lives through education
  • Strong communication and classroom management skills
  • Ability to adapt to a variety of learning needs and environments
